The Sustainability Consortium update: Type III product declaration development for laptops

One of the goals of The Sustainability Consortium (TSC) is to bridge the divide between rigorous scientific analysis of the life cycle of consumer goods and the ability of the purchaser/ consumer to absorb and act on the environmental impact information provided from such an analysis. TSC has approached this issue through the development of the Sustainability Measurement and Reporting System (SMRS), which describes a process that facilitates the communication of environmental impacts derived from life cycle analysis to a broader lay audience. Based on ISO 14025 Type III environmental declarations, the SMRS provides the common rules for reporting impacts and creates a product declaration that can underpin any number of consumer communication modes. This paper presents the SMRS methodology and its application to laptop computers.
